I don't know about you guys, but when I have to send in a defective product still on warranty, I still have to pay shipping to get it back to the manufacturer / distributor.

I agree, it sucks to receive a broken item, but you can't hold the vendor responsible for shipping costs, specially if they're offering to replace the item.

It's not necessarily the vendor's fault that the item was broken, but they are backing the product they sell by replacing it, no?

Shipping stuff has a cost. Deal with it.

The warranty covers the product I purchased. The shipping is technically a service purchased from a different company than the vendor, so the warranty in no way applies to this additional service. That's how it's always been for me anyways when I've dealt with warranties, unless there were some seriously messed up complication.
